What is preventative care?
Preventive care is the combination of regular examinations, vaccinations, screenings, and other medical services that your veterinarian performs when your pet comes in for a visit. These procedures allow your vet to create a health history or your pet, and catch and treat small health issues before they turn into big problems.
Do puppies and kittens need preventive care?
Yes. Illness doesn’t discriminate, and starting your pet of right away with preventive care will ensure they have a long, happy, and healthy life. Vaccines to prevent diseases like rabies and distemper should be given to your pet early on in his life, and spaying or neutering your pet early on will prevent many health and behavioral issues.
Do senior pets need preventive care?
Yes again. As a pet ages, different health concerns can crop up. Regular checkups and screening can catch these health issues, and allow your pet to live comfortably as they transition into their golden years. The preventive services for senior pets include: biannual checkups, dental cleanings, vaccinations, blood and urine screenings, parasite control, and more.

Is a Wellness Plan an insurance policy?
No. Wellness Plans aren’t the same thing as pet insurance. Pet insurance helps to offset the cost of major health issues like severe illness or unexpected injury, whereas Wellness Plans are meant to help you manage the cost of your pet’s preventive care services.
